Patent number: 8282104Abstract: The reduction in real operation objects in game systems that use real operation objects is detected. The quantity of real operation objects, which are repeatedly used by being circulated, is detected, it is judged whether the quantity is sufficient or not, and the judging results are output. For example, in a ball throwing game, balls are used in rotation by repeatedly supplying and recovering the balls. The quantity of balls in circulation is detected, and if the quantity is less than a threshold value, the manager of the game system is notified whether a sufficient quantity of balls is being supplied to the player or not, by for example outputting a warning message. By playing with an insufficient quantity of balls the level of difficulty of the game is essentially increased, so the player will feel that this is unfair.Type: GrantFiled: August 7, 2008Date of Patent: October 9, 2012Assignee: Konami Digital Entertainment Co., Ltd.Inventors: Nobuya Okuda, Toru Takeda, Shingo Onkoshi, Tadasu Kitae

Patent number: 8282531Abstract: An engine rotational speed control apparatus is provide to prevent a degradation of fuel efficiency caused by an unnecessary increase of the rotational speed of an engine when a depression amount of an accelerator pedal is briefly increased and then immediately decreased. In particular, when the vehicle is accelerated, an optimum fuel efficiency operating point along an optimum fuel efficiency curve is not moved immediately to another optimum fuel efficiency operating point corresponding to a new target drive force. Instead, the target drive force is reached by increasing the engine load while increasing the engine rotational speed as little as possible, and thus using an operating point that does not lie on the optimum fuel efficiency curve.Type: GrantFiled: April 1, 2010Date of Patent: October 9, 2012Assignee: Nissan Motor Co., Ltd.Inventors: Masanori Ishido, Atsufumi Kobayashi

Patent number: 8282519Abstract: An electric derailleur motor unit is provided for a motorized derailleur assembly. The electric derailleur motor unit has a derailleur motor support, a derailleur motor, a drive train and an output shaft. The derailleur motor is mounted to the derailleur motor support and has a driving shaft. The drive train has at least one intermediate gear operatively coupled to the driving shaft of the derailleur motor and a worm gear operatively coupled to the intermediate gear such that rotation of the driving shaft of the derailleur motor rotates the intermediate gear which in turn rotates the worm gear. The output shaft is operatively coupled to the derailleur motor and rotatably supported on the derailleur motor support. The output shaft has an output gear engaged with the worm gear of the drive train.Type: GrantFiled: January 17, 2008Date of Patent: October 9, 2012Assignee: Shimano Inc.Inventors: Tadashi Ichida, Kazuhiro Fujii
